This book is an excellent detailed study of life as a foriegner in revolutionary France. This book makes the valid point that, whilst the French Revolution brought about massive change and freedom for French citizens, foriegners had a very different experience. Rapport writes with clarity and a genuine enthusiasm for his subject. This makes it even more of a pity that the price is so prohibitive. If this book was more widely avaliable, it would be a must have for anyone with an interest in revolutionary France. As it stands, serious scholars should still go out of their way to read this.
